Job Description
Amazon’s Alexa Ads team is also hiring at senior level in Bengaluru. This senior applied scientist will lead deep learning and generative AI work for agentic and conversational advertising in Alexa+, including models that personalise interactions and place sponsored content within a conversation. The posting asks for at least six years of building ML models for business use, and a strong say in the new team’s science direction.

About the Alexa Ads team
Alexa Ads is setting up a new science team in Bangalore. The posting describes it as a greenfield group: rather than tuning mature models, the team is rethinking how ads are ranked, priced and personalised across voice-first and screen-first surfaces, and early members help set the science roadmap and team culture.

How to prepare for this application
- Lead with scope: describe a model or system you owned end to end and what it changed.
- GenAI in ranking: think about where LLMs help or hurt in ad selection and how you would test that.
- Team building: expect questions on hiring, mentoring and setting technical direction.
- Pick your level: an Applied Scientist II role on the same team is listed separately.
- Leadership Principles: Amazon interviews lean on them; prepare two or three STAR stories for each.
